Forest Park Forever is accepting applications for its Forest Park Forever Artist in Residence Program.
There will be up to three residencies available for regional artists of all disciplines and backgrounds — from poets and choreographers to painters and photographers and beyond. Each artist will receive a $3,000 stipend from Forest Park Forever to produce their work or series of works, plus a budget to create a public event at the end of their residency. None of the artwork will be permanently displayed in Forest Park.
Artists will be expected to work on-site in Forest Park for 10 hours per week for three weeks and are encouraged to collaborate and learn from the horticulturists, gardeners and other professionals from Forest Park Forever and the city. Residencies will take place between May and September 2016.
